#導入擴展庫importre#正則表達式庫importcollections#詞頻統計庫importnumpyasnp#numpy數據處理庫importjieba#結巴分詞importwordcloud#詞云展示庫fromPILimportImage#圖像處理庫importmatplotlib.pyplotasplt#圖像展示庫#讀取文件fn=open('c.csv')#打開文件string_data=fn.read()#讀出整個文件fn.close()#
系統 2019-09-27 17:52:07 2161
背景由于python自帶的源下載速度非常慢,特別是安裝一些庫的時候,甚至有時會失敗。pip國內的一些鏡像阿里云http://mirrors.aliyun.com/pypi/simple/中國科技大學https://pypi.mirrors.ustc.edu.cn/simple/豆瓣(douban)http://pypi.douban.com/simple/清華大學https://pypi.tuna.tsinghua.edu.cn/simple/替換首先在w
系統 2019-09-27 17:51:07 2161
Python-Jenkins常用APIjenkins.Jenkins(url,username=None,password=None,timeout=,resolve=True)#創建jenkins實例參數:url–jenkins服務器地址,strusername–用戶名,strpassword–密碼,strtimeout–連接超時時間(default:notset),intresolve–Attemptstoresolveandauto-correctA
系統 2019-09-27 17:46:57 2161
本文實例為大家分享了PythonOpenCV調用攝像頭檢測人臉并截圖的具體代碼,供大家參考,具體內容如下注意:需要在python中安裝OpenCV庫,同時需要下載OpenCV人臉識別模型haarcascade_frontalface_alt.xml,模型可在OpenCV-PCA-KNN-SVM_face_recognition中下載。使用OpenCV調用攝像頭檢測人臉并連續截圖100張#-*-coding:utf-8-*-#import進openCV的庫i
系統 2019-09-27 17:46:16 2161
importrename1="a#pple"#命名正確,aname2="apple!"ret=re.match("[a-zA-Z_][a-zA-Z0-9_]*",name1)ifret:print("命名正確,",ret.group())else:print("命名不正確")明明命名不合法,為什么返回正確,而且只匹配到正確部分因為默認match只會匹配開頭(如果開頭正確了,就等于匹配成功了)嚴格的匹配開頭與結尾加上^和$(表示開頭和結尾)importren
系統 2019-09-27 17:56:36 2160
在pythonsocket編程中,有兩個發送TCP的函數,send()與sendall(),區別如下:socket.send(string[,flags])發送TCP數據,返回發送的字節大小。這個字節長度可能少于實際要發送的數據的長度。換句話說,這個函數執行一次,并不一定能發送完給定的數據,可能需要重復多次才能發送完成。例子:data="somethingyouwanttosend"whileTrue:len=s.send(data[len:])ifnot
系統 2019-09-27 17:55:38 2160
一、參考資料[1].pandas.DataFrame.to_excel[2].WorkingwithPythonPandasandXlsxWriter二、程序示例1.pandas.DataFrame.to_excel最簡單的寫入當寫入的文件只占有一個sheet時,可以利用pandas.DataFrame.to_excel()直接寫入。該函數的用法如下,關于參數的具體介紹,可以參考參考資料[1]的內容。DataFrame.to_excel(excel_wri
系統 2019-09-27 17:55:29 2160
matplotlib圖例中文亂碼以及坐標負號顯示在圖片的標簽名,標題名或者圖例中出現中文時,直接運行會出現亂碼,文字顯示為框框importmatplotlib.pyplotaspltplt.figure()plt.title("哈哈")plt.show()快速解決辦法在導入模塊后加入下面代碼plt.rcParams['font.sans-serif']=['SimHei']#用來正常顯示中文標簽plt.rcParams['axes.unicode_minu
系統 2019-09-27 17:52:29 2160
識別快遞單號這次跟老師做項目,這項目大概是流水線上識別快遞上的快遞單號。首先我嘗試了解條形碼的基本知識百度百科:條形碼條形碼(barcode)是將寬度不等的多個黑條和空白,按照一定的編碼規則排列,用以表達一組信息的圖形標識符。常見的條形碼是由反射率相差很大的黑條(簡稱條)和白條(簡稱空)排成的平行線圖案。條形碼可以標出物品的生產國、制造廠家、商品名稱、生產日期、圖書分類號、郵件起止地點、類別、日期等許多信息,因而在商品流通、圖書管理、郵政管理、銀行系統等許
系統 2019-09-27 17:51:51 2160
目錄1.模擬退火算法實現步驟2.python實現3.實驗結果4.參考文獻模擬退火算法的基本原理在這里就不一一贅述了,關于原理,可以參考百度百科、博客1、博客2在本節按照基本實現步驟實現模擬退火算法,對于模擬退火算法的高級封裝(類封裝),可以參考模擬退火算法之特征選擇的python實現(二)1.模擬退火算法實現步驟2.python實現importnumpyasnpfromsklearn.preprocessingimportStandardScalerfro
系統 2019-09-27 17:51:34 2160
目標:從零部署機器學習開發環境,包括python3.7安裝、anaconda安裝、虛擬環境部署、jupyternotebook界面優化、簡單程序運行1、python安裝https://www.python.org/2、anaconda安裝https://www.anaconda.com/3、虛擬環境部署為方便后續開發,使用anaconda部署新的開發環境3.1、enviroment》base》openterminal3.2、condacreate-nenv
系統 2019-09-27 17:47:18 2160
一.基本數據類型整數:int字符串:str(注:\t等于一個tab鍵)布爾值:bool列表:list列表用[]元祖:tuple元祖用()字典:dict注:所有的數據類型都存在想對應的類列里,元祖和列表功能一樣,列表可以修改,元祖不能修改。二.列表所有數據類型:基本操作:索引,切片,長度,包含,循環classtuple(object):"""tuple()->emptytupletuple(iterable)->tupleinitializedfromite
系統 2019-09-27 17:38:46 2160
這篇文章討論Python中下劃線_的使用。跟Python中很多用法類似,下劃線_的不同用法絕大部分(不全是)都是一種慣例約定。一、單個下劃線直接做變量名(_)主要有三種情況:1.解釋器中_符號是指交互解釋器中最后一次執行語句的返回結果。這種用法最初出現在CPython解釋器中,其他解釋器后來也都跟進了。復制代碼代碼如下:>>>_Traceback(mostrecentcalllast):File"",line1,inNameError:name'_'isn
系統 2019-09-27 17:37:41 2160
python中有try——except的方法捕獲異常,可以獲取到異常的種類以及自定義異常,但是有時候對于debug測試來說,信息不全,比如說觸發異常的具體位置在哪:importtracebacktry:num=int('abc')exceptException:traceback.print_exc()traceback.print_exc()直接打印異常traceback.format_exc()返回字符串還可以將信息寫入到文件traceback.pri
系統 2019-09-27 17:57:31 2159
python學習記錄1——常用命令總結with關鍵字Python中的關鍵字with詳解淺談Python的with語句structPython使用struct處理二進制(pack和unpack用法)lambda表達式python–lambda表達式@裝飾器特點:1參數是一個函數;2返回值是一個函數python裝飾器Python函數裝飾器裝飾器-廖雪峰的官方網站defaultdict方法python中defaultdict方法的使用對dict進行排序pytho
系統 2019-09-27 17:56:11 2159